Abstract:
Embodiments of the invention relate to a reamer for machining a workpiece by chip removal. Embodiments of the reamer can incorporate a holder, having a receiving opening disposed on a workpiece-side end face and having an internal thread, a holder bore extending inside the holder in a longitudinal direction thereof and opening into the receiving opening, an exchangeable head, having a cutting-nose element having a plurality of cutting noses disposed in a distributed manner in a circumferential direction, an exchangeable-head shank having an external thread corresponding to the internal thread disposed in the receiving opening, a bearing contact element disposed between the cutting-nose element and the exchangeable-head shank and having a first bearing contact surface for bearing contact on a first support surface disposed on the workpiece-side end face, with an exchangeable-head bore corresponding to the holder bore extends through the exchangeable head in a longitudinal direction thereof.
